I am pleased to invite you to submit your work to the minitrack "Dark Sides
and Criminal Uses of Digital and Intelligent Technologies," which I am
co-chairing as part of the upcoming Hawaii International Conference on
System Sciences (HICSS-59), to be held January 6–9, 2026, at the Hyatt
Regency Resort, Maui, Hawaii.

This minitrack explores the negative consequences of digitalization and
artificial intelligence at the individual, organizational, and societal
levels. We welcome theoretical, empirical, and technical contributions
examining topics such as:

Algorithmic bias, datafication, and fairness
Addictive and impulsive technology use
Cyberviolence, cybercrime, and digital deviance
Misinformation, deepfakes, and ethical challenges of generative AI
Psychological effects of digital technologies, including technostress
Security breaches, phishing, ransomware, and online scams
Policy and regulatory implications

We aim to foster critical reflection and discussion about the risks posed
by digital and intelligent technologies, as well as strategies and
interventions to mitigate these dark sides.
